A regular pentagon has 5 lines of symmetry, running from each vertex to the midpoint of the opposite side. These lines are not to be confused with the five lines it takes to draw a pentagon. Every regular polygon has as many lines of symmetry as there are lines in the polygon.An irregular pentagon may have none or 1 line of symmetry.
